
Блокчейн – это децентрализованная цепочка блоков, где каждый блок содержит набор транзакций и уникальный хеш предыдущего блока. Такой протокол обеспечивает неизменность и прозрачность данных за счёт криптографии и распределённой сети узлов. Принципы работы блокчейна основаны на подтверждении достоверности транзакций через механизмы майнинга или стейкинга, что гарантирует надежность всей цепочки.
Введение в базовые понятия блокчейна предполагает понимание ключевых элементов: узел, хеш, смартконтракт и транзакция. Узлы поддерживают сеть, проверяют поступающие данные и обновляют локальный реестр. Смартконтракты автоматизируют выполнение условий в цепочке, расширяя сферы применения технологии – от финансов до логистики. Практические кейсы показывают, как протоколы блокчейна применяются для обеспечения безопасности, прозрачности и децентрализации.
Я рассматриваю основные принципы блокчейна: консенсус, защиту данных с помощью криптографии и процессы валидации. Майнинг выступает не только как механизм добавления новых блоков, но и как экономический стимул участников сети. Изучение практических примеров, таких как торговля криптовалютами или системы голосования, помогает понять возможности и ограничения технологии от начального уровня до продвинутого применения.
Основы блокчейна: ключевые принципы, механизмы и практические примеры
Для понимания блокчейна важно сразу выделить ключевые понятия: цепочка блоков, транзакция, узел и протокол. Блокчейн представляет собой распределённый реестр, где каждая транзакция фиксируется в блоке и добавляется к цепочке с помощью криптографических механизмов. Основной принцип – децентрализация, при которой данные хранятся не на одном сервере, а на множестве узлов, обеспечивая прозрачность и безопасность.
Криптография лежит в основе блокчейна: хеш-функции гарантируют целостность данных, а цифровые подписи подтверждают авторство транзакций. Майнинг – механизм подтверждения блоков в публичных сетях, таких как Bitcoin и Ethereum, – базируется на решении сложных вычислительных задач, что требует ресурсов и защищает от подделок. Отметим, что в некоторых сетях вместо майнинга используется стейкинг, где уделяется внимание вложению токенов для обеспечения безопасности.
Практическое применение блокчейна выходит за рамки криптовалют. Смартконтракты – программируемые договоры, работающие на блокчейне – автоматизируют выполнение условий без посредников. В кейсах использования смартконтрактов выделяются:
- децентрализованные финансы (DeFi), обеспечивающие кредитование и трейдинг без традиционных банков;
- цепочки поставок, где каждая партия товара регистрируется в блокчейне для устранения подделок;
- голосования, гарантирующие прозрачность и неподкупность процедуры.
Выделяют несколько ключевых протоколов и механизмов, формирующих архитектуру блокчейна:
- Протокол консенсуса – алгоритм, определяющий порядок подтверждения транзакций, например, Proof of Work или Proof of Stake;
- Механизмы шифрования – обеспечивают конфиденциальность и аутентичность данных;
- Распределённые сети – обеспечивают устойчивость к сбоям и атакам за счёт децентрализации узлов;
- Модели хранения данных – блоки содержат заголовок с хешем предыдущего блока, что создаёт непрерывную цепочку.
Введение в основы блокчейна требует понимания баланса между децентрализацией, масштабируемостью и безопасностью. Примеры успешных проектов помогают оценить плюсы и минусы цепочек. Например, в Ethereum быстрое выполнение смартконтрактов обеспечивает широкие возможности приложений, но высокая нагрузка приводит к росту комиссий. В Bitcoin майнинг занимает ключевое место, гарантируя безопасность сети, но энергозатраты остаются важным вопросом.
Изучение механизмов и принципов блокчейна позволяет применять его в различных сферах: финансовые услуги, управление активами, идентификация, торговля и логистика. Глубокое понимание базовых понятий и протоколов – необходимое условие для анализа кейсов и выбора подходящих инструментов для конкретных задач.
Как работает блокчейн
Майнинг и консенсусные протоколы – ключевые механизмы, обеспечивающие обновление блокчейна. В Proof of Work (PoW) майнеры решают криптографические задачи, чтобы создать новый блок и получить вознаграждение. Такая система создаёт конкуренцию и препятствует фальсификациям. В примерах Proof of Stake (PoS) участники подтверждают блоки, удерживая и блокируя своей монеты, что снижает энергозатраты и повышает скорость обработки транзакций.
Децентрализация – одна из ключевых концепций блокчейна, исключающая наличие единой точки отказа. Каждый узел проверяет транзакции и блоки по протоколу, обеспечивая безопасность и синхронизацию данных в сети. Это повышает устойчивость к атакам и снижает риски манипуляций, что широко используется в практических кейсых, например при защите финансовых операций и цифровых активов.
Для расширения функционала применяются смартконтракты – программные скрипты, автоматически исполняющие условия сделок. В примерах их внедрения – децентрализованные финансовые платформы (DeFi) и автоматизированные торговые системы, которые минимизируют человеческий фактор и ошибку. При этом криптография гарантирует неподдельность подписей и конфиденциальность данных.
Практические применения блокчейна охватывают управление цепочками поставок, голосование, хранение медицинских записей. Каждый кейс опирается на сочетание базовых понятий и современных принципов, от криптографии до консенсусных моделей, формируя устойчивые и прозрачные системы, способные решать реальные задачи в различных индустриях.
Принципы безопасности и децентрализации
Ключевые механизмы защиты в блокчейне основаны на криптографии и распределённом протоколе, где каждый узел сети хранит полную копию цепочки блоков. Для обеспечения безопасности транзакций применяется хеш-функция – уникальный цифровой отпечаток данных блока, связанный с предыдущим блоком, что исключает возможность их подделки или изменения задним числом. Такой механизм предотвращает атаки на целостность данных, поскольку подделка одного блока требует пересчёта всех последующих, что практически невыполнимо при большом количестве узлов.
Децентрализация как базовый принцип блокчейна снижает риски централизации власти и уязвимостей. Каждый узел сети участвует в проверке и подтверждении транзакций, что исключает единственный точечный сбой или контроль. Практические кейсы, например, работа сети Ethereum с её смартконтрактами, демонстрируют, как автоматизация логики транзакций и распределение управления повышают устойчивость протокола к взломам и ошибкам. Смартконтракты обеспечивают механизмы прозрачного исполнения договоренностей без посредников, повышая безопасность бизнес-процессов.
Механизмы защиты на примере майнинга и стейкинга
Механизм майнинга (Proof of Work) используется для подтверждения транзакций и генерации новых блоков через решение сложных вычислительных задач. Он обеспечивает безопасность цепочки блоков за счёт затрат вычислительной мощности, что снижает риск злоупотреблений. Однако высокое энергопотребление этого подхода вызвало развитие альтернативных протоколов, таких как Proof of Stake, где право добавления нового блока зависит от объёма заблокированных токенов. Этот метод сохраняет базовые принципы децентрализации, снижая практические издержки и повышая устойчивость против атак.
Пример практического применения безопасности в блокчейне
Введение мультиподписей и аппаратных ключей в криптографии повысило безопасность хранения активов пользователей, сокращая риски потери средств или взлома кошельков. Торговые платформы и децентрализованные биржи активно используют эти механизмы, минимизируя возможность несанкционированного доступа к средствам. Кейсы крупного обмена криптовалютами подтверждают, что сочетание распределённого протокола блокчейна и современных криптографических решений формирует надёжный фундамент для практических применений технологии.
Реальные примеры использования блокчейна
Блокчейн применяется в различных сферах, демонстрируя практические кейсы, которые опираются на ключевые принципы и механизмы технологии. Например, в финансовом секторе внедрение смартконтрактов автоматизирует процесс выполнений обязательств, снижая риски и исключая посредников. Транзакции здесь подтверждаются узлами сети, где каждый блок содержит хеш предыдущего, обеспечивая неизменность данных и прозрачность.
В области логистики базовые понятия блокчейна используются для отслеживания движения грузов от производителя до конечного потребителя. Благодаря децентрализации, информация о каждой транзакции записывается на всех узлах, что препятствует подделке и манипуляциям с данными. Майнинг поддерживает актуальность реестра, обновляя блоки в соответствии с установленным протоколом.
Примером технологического применения является управление цифровыми активами и токенизация собственности. Здесь криптография обеспечивает защиту ключей и подтверждение прав владения, а смартконтракты автоматизируют обмены и выплаты, снижая издержки и время проведения операций. Практические механизмы блокчейна: позволяют создавать надежные и прозрачные системы, от которых зависит эффективность и безопасность бизнеса.
Промышленность и государственный сектор переходят к использованию блокчейн-решений в сфере верификации документов, голосовании и защите данных. Введение этих систем базируется на ключевых понятиях безопасности и децентрализации, когда каждый узел сети участвует валидации транзакций и хранении базовых данных без центрального контроля. Такой подход минимизирует риски мошенничества и повышает доверие участников.










